HB 5303 Summary
-
Establishes the iBudget system for home and community-based Medicaid waiver services, allocating individual budgets to clients based on assessment instruments and an allocation algorithm tied to level of need.
-
Creates a four-tiered waiver system with annual expenditure caps: Tier 1 ($150,000 per client, with exceptions for intensive medical/behavioral needs), Tier 2 ($53,625), Tier 3 ($34,125), and Tier 4 ($14,422).
-
Requires clients to exhaust all available resources including state Medicaid plan services, school-based services, and private insurance before using iBudget funds.
-
Allows the agency to approve increases to base iBudget allocations for clients with extraordinary medical/behavioral needs, significant temporary support needs, or permanent changes in circumstances that cannot be met within the algorithm-determined amount.
-
Creates the Services for Children with Developmental Disabilities Task Force to develop recommendations and a plan for establishing the Developmental Disabilities Savings Program, with final report due by April 2, 2012.
